Ischemia, alloantigen, and gene transfer induce cardiac genes differentially

Published in Gene Therapy Weekly, December 4th, 2003

Ischemia, alloantigen, and gene transfer induce cardiac genes differentially.

"Transplantation of allogeneic grafts presents several challenges to the innate and adaptive immune systems including chemokine leukocyte recruitment, activation, and effector function. We defined the chemokines and receptors induced by the transplant procedure/ischemia injury, alloantigen and gene transfer vector administration in murine cardiac grafts. E1 E3 deleted AdRSVPgal was transferred into grafts at the time of transplantation, grafts were harvested after 1-14 days, and a pathway-specific cDNA array was used to evaluate the levels of 67 chemokine and chemokine receptor genes,"...
